Salaries and KPIs: the hidden pitfalls of staff costs

«Five people at 100k each means 500k payroll.» In simple terms, yes. But vacations, sick leave and turnover change the picture — unless you plan for them.

What's actually hard about calculating payroll? Five people at 100k each — that's 500k in staff costs. Plus a 10% bonus on a million in turnover — another 100k. Total: 600k. In simplified form, that's exactly right. But there are nuances.

People take vacations

If you don't build it into the rotation in advance, during a vacation you'll either have to pause the employee's function or find a temporary replacement — while still paying the salary. A simple fix: add an extra 1/12 of the annual salary (with 30 days of vacation) straight into the payroll budget.

People get sick

Same as vacations, except nobody agrees on it in advance. In some countries a person can officially stay on sick leave at your expense for months. The fix is the same — build in a «cushion». If you don't need it, throw a team party.

People quit

An employee has the right to leave with N days' notice (or «accidentally» fall ill the day after resigning). You'll have to find and train a replacement. Who will do it, and how long will it take? Even if it's you — you're pulled away from other tasks, and that costs money too. The fix: accept in advance that turnover exists, and keep a minimal reserve of time and money to cover it.

The takeaway: learn to plan for unforeseen (or actually foreseeable?) circumstances in advance, to avoid financial shocks and keep the team's morale up.
